Introduction

Keokuk is a full displacement, long-range passage maker. Her current owner purchased her from the original owner, who incorporated several unique features that add to the appearance and simplicity of operation as well as reduced maintenance. If your search has taken you to Nordhavn, Krogen or Selene, it would behoove you to seriously consider this gorgeous 52-foot twin-engine trawler. She is equipped with the same quality brand equipment — reliable John Deere 6-cylinder engines, Northern Lights generator, Garmin plotters, Furuno radar — in a more affordable package. She is just as easily run from her climate-controlled pilothouse as from her fully enclosed flybridge. With full 360-degree views, twin screws and bow thruster, she can manage tight docking situations as well as any locks, evidenced by her heritage as a two-time Great Loop veteran.

Keokuk was built in mainland China by Seahorse Marine, an accomplished vessel designer and manufacturer with over 30 years of experience, whose attention to quality and detail led to their selection as builder of several of the award-winning George Buehler-designed Diesel Ducks. She boasts a very practical and truly spacious layout beautifully appointed with rich, old-world teak joinery, traditional teak and holly flooring, and modern touches including granite countertops, stainless-steel appliances and LED lighting. Keokuk's spacious layout is due to her "widebody" saloon with one side deck to starboard, allowing for a much larger middle-level living space. Her design includes a sea-kindly and proven Blaine Seeley hull, a raised pilothouse with excellent 360-degree visibility, high stainless-steel railings around the entire vessel, commercial-grade watertight doors, and a protected starboard side deck.

Boarding

Keokuk can be easily and safely boarded from four locations around the vessel. From the dock you can board through her hinged boarding gate aft, molded into the hull on the starboard side. She is also equipped with two custom stainless-steel boarding gates that allow direct boarding at the port and starboard pilothouse doors, and a folding stainless-steel boarding gate astern that allows direct access from the water onto the integrated swim step and into the cockpit through a hinged door molded into the transom.

Cockpit

The cockpit, aft of the saloon, is a popular hangout area with room for outdoor chairs. It is protected by the boat deck overhang, which provides shade for relaxing whether in port, at anchor or underway, and shelter from sun and rain. From the cockpit, the entry to the saloon is impressive, with two hinged opening doors and windows that really open this space up and merge the indoor and outdoor living space into one large, airy room.

Saloon

Inside the saloon to port there is a large U-shaped settee and table. For additional seating there is also a custom oval bench which can be used as an ottoman for the built-in curved settee to starboard; this oval bench doubles as a coffee table, ottoman or dining table for two. The view from the saloon is magnificent, with large sliding windows outboard and aft providing a feeling of openness with excellent all-around visibility and air flow. Keokuk is an all-weather cruiser with a robust Hurricane diesel furnace for cold winter days and dual Cruisair reverse cycle HVAC providing 32,000 BTUs to keep you cool on the hottest of days.

Galley

The galley is forward to port, spacious and integrated with the saloon but separated by attractive granite counters. In the galley you will find stainless appliances including a Nova Kool standup refrigerator/freezer, a Broadwater 4-burner propane stove, a GE Profile convection/microwave, and a U-Line under-counter ice maker. There is also a GE trash compactor and a fabulous custom fold-down teak dish rack, and over the stove an Ariston hood with integrated fan and external exhaust. The galley features plenty of counter space and teak storage cabinets.

Across from the galley is a Splendide washer/dryer and an integrated entertainment center housing the 26" Samsung TV with DirecTV, all new in 2018, finished in a granite countertop carrying the theme from the galley. There is also a central vacuum system, and forward of the entertainment center on the starboard side is a custom wine locker.

Pilothouse

Moving forward from the saloon is another of Keokuk's key features for safe, all-weather, around-the-clock cruising: a raised, well-protected, professionally appointed pilothouse featuring a curved settee with teak table, a freezer underneath, and a Stidd helm chair. For ease of moving around the pilothouse, the table folds using a custom piano hinge. The look of the pilothouse is all business with its traditional teak helm, custom leather chair, raked-back forward windows, watertight Dutch doors, and chart table with storage underneath. Keokuk's navigation system is run by an upgraded Garmin 7612 plotter and Furuno radar backed up by Furuno NavNet with C-MAP integration. Add in dual engine controls, dual Flo Scan fuel burn gauges, a rear-mounted camera, tank monitoring panel, VHF radio and spotlight control.

Staterooms

From the pilothouse, moving forward down a curved stairway with teak safety rails, you reach a landing that allows you to move forward and aft. Moving aft you enter the midship owner stateroom with centerline queen bed — the closer to the center of the boat, the more stable the ride. This full-width stateroom also has a built-in desk to port and a comfy built-in love seat with a large opening porthole above for light and ventilation. The head and tub shower are ensuite to port; both heads feature high-end stainless faucets and granite countertops. Forward you pass the guest head with full shower to starboard, then enter the guest stateroom up front, which also features a centerline queen berth and a pair of full-length hanging lockers.

Engine Room

The engine room and generator/electrical/battery room are located below the saloon with two through-floor entries — a smaller hatch aft in the saloon leads directly to the generator/battery room, and a long lifting hatch further forward leads directly to the engine room; both rooms are connected via a small door with viewing port. The engine room features twin John Deere 6068TFM marine diesel engines and Twin Disc ZF transmissions, arranged for easy service and inspection. The Racor filters are logically located on the forward bulkhead. Sea water for the engine, generator, watermaker and water heater is provided by a practical sea chest. There are five fiberglass fuel tanks holding 1,000 gallons of diesel and a robust fuel transfer system. Keokuk is outfitted with a Northern Lights generator; the dedicated generator start battery, house batteries and start batteries were all replaced in 2020. The batteries and generator are complemented with a Magnum 2500 inverter and Xantrex charger.

Foredeck

The entire outside deck area is protected by tall stainless-steel railings. On the foredeck, just below the forward pilothouse windows, is a bench seat for relaxing and large storage lockers that house the propane tanks, with plenty of room for fenders, lines and other deck gear. Further forward, the foredeck is smooth and uncluttered, with the windlass and ground tackle up front including foot pedals for raising and lowering the anchor. Using the foredeck ground tackle and the Muir windlass controls in the pilothouse or flybridge makes anchoring Keokuk straightforward and stress free, even singlehanded.

Boat Deck

From the foredeck, walking aft to port, you go up a couple of fiberglass steps to arrive at the boat deck. This area has a stainless davit with electric hoist for easily launching and retrieving the 9'6" Zodiac propelled by an efficient Yamaha 6 HP 4-stroke outboard. Noteworthy is the stainless hinge and struts at the base of the folding mast, making this boat Great Loop friendly when you need to lower her profile.

Aft Deck

The aft deck is roomy and contains moveable seating. A transom door provides access to the integrated swim platform, which has built-in storage and a hot and cold shower for rinsing off or showering.
